FPGA
文章平均质量分 65
流年過客
硬件攻城狮
展开
-
Xilinx ZYNQ简介之Zynq® UltraScale+™系列
一、Zynq-7000 系列ZYNQ (全称是 Zynq-7000 All Programmable SoC全可编程片上系统APSoC)是赛灵思公司(Xilinx)推出的新一代全可编程片上系统(APSoC),它将处理器的软件可编程性与 FPGA 的硬件可编程性进行完美整合,以提供无与伦比的系统性能、灵活性与可扩展性。与传统 SoC解决方案不同的是,高度灵活的可编程逻辑(FPGA)可以实现系统的优化和差异化,允许添加定制外设与加速器,从而适应各种广泛的应用。ZYNQ 的本质特征,是它组合了一个双核 ARM C原创 2022-06-15 10:08:56 · 2737 阅读 · 0 评论 -
赛灵思FPGA功耗实测与XPE模拟计算对比分析
FPGA选型的时候,除了考虑其性能,硬件上还需要额外关注其功耗,因为这涉及到相应的DCDC的选型,但是如何评估FPGA的功耗呢?今天这里就以一款赛灵思Kintex-7系列的XC7K160T-FFG676芯片为例,其相应的应用资源如下图所示:首先先用赛灵思的专用模拟分析软件XPE进行一下满功耗的模拟分析计算,计算结果如下图所示:模拟在满载的情况下,On-Chip Power功耗为:5.928W;表中其他详细参数信息含义可参考赛灵思FPGA手册。接下来使用实际PCB板卡进行测试,这里板卡实际同样按照原创 2022-05-17 23:16:27 · 4064 阅读 · 0 评论 -
Xilinx 7系列FPGA数据手册:概述--中文版
Xilinx®7系列FPGA包括四个FPGA家族,可满足完整范围的系统需求,从低成本、小尺寸、成本敏感、高容量应用到超高端连接带宽、逻辑容量和信号处理能力,适用于最苛刻的高性能应用。7系列fpga包括:1、Spartan®-7系列:优化的低成本,最低功率,高I / O性能,封装最小。2、Artix®-7系列:针对需要串行收发器和高DSP和逻辑吞吐量的低功耗应用进行优化。为高吞吐量、成本敏感的应用提供最低的材料成本总额。3、Kintex®-7系列:与上一代相比,优化了最佳的性价比,系统性能提升了2原创 2022-02-20 21:21:16 · 9365 阅读 · 0 评论 -
基于Xilinx的FPGA下载配置详解及几种电路参考设计
针对不同的器件类型和应用场合,Xilinx为其FPGA系列产品提供了多种下载配置模式,比如:JTAG模式、Parallel模式、Master Serial模式、Slave Serial模式、Master Select MAP模式、Slave Select MAP模式。下面就来详细介绍一下每种下载模式以及配置操作等。1.JTAG模式:该模式是基于IEEE1149.1和IEEE1532的下载配置模式,通过TDI(数据输入)、TDO(数据输出)、TMS(测试模式)、TCK(测试时钟)四个信号实现FPGA的下载原创 2021-12-09 22:38:51 · 2025 阅读 · 0 评论 -
FPGA篇:M0-M2配置详解
M0-M2主要用于配置SPI的模式,详细介绍如下:FPGA配置方式灵活多样,根据芯片是否可以主动加载配置数据分为主从模式以及JTAG模式。1.主模式:主模式都是加载片外非易失性存储器中的配置,所需要的时钟信号由FPGA内部产生;在主模式下,FPGA上电后自动将配置数据从相应的外部存储器中读取到SRAM中,实现内部结构映射;主模式根据比特流位宽又可以分为:串行模式和并行模式两大类。如主串行模式、主spi flash 串行模式、内部主spi flash串行模式、主bpi并行模式以及主并行模式,如下图原创 2021-12-06 22:42:37 · 5986 阅读 · 0 评论 -
FPGA基础–基于Vivado的眼图测试(二)
四、生成.mcs文件1.在“TCl Cons…”选项框中输入如下内容:红色文字部分是第三步中生成的.bit文件的地址及文件名,蓝色部分是即将生成的.mcs文件的地址及文件名;2.输入完成后,单击回车,文件开始编译,出现如下提示则编译完成:蓝色文字部分为创建新项目时自定义的项目文件夹目录,红色文字部分是生成的.bit文件及.mcs文件后自动生成的文件夹地址;.mcs文件于测试准备阶段烧写入待测试板卡中;.bit文件于测试过程中提供在线调试使用。五、测试准备1.将待测试的输入输出板卡烧写.原创 2021-11-30 21:59:37 · 2945 阅读 · 0 评论 -
FPGA基础--基于Vivado的眼图测试(一)
对于信号眼图分析相信大家都不陌生,除了使用示波器可以测试眼图外,使用Vivado同样可以进行眼图的测试与分析。说起Vivado,FPGA研发设计人员肯定是玩的666,但是对于硬件研发及测试人员来说,还是比较陌生的,今天就来讲一下用Vivado如何进行信号眼图测试。操作步骤一、项目建立:1.打开Vivado软件,如下图所示:2.点击Create new project, 如下图所示:3.在new project窗口中,点击next,如下图所示:4.输入新建的项目名称及路径,如下图所示:5原创 2021-11-25 10:23:06 · 2175 阅读 · 0 评论